    Yup.

    Too much breeding goes into speed and endurance but they overlook legs. Which is why so many break down. Not to mention their joints don't finish fully developing until 4 or 5 years and we ride and train them super young and race them hard at 3.

    The stallion Big Brown is a good example. Fast and a huge money earner but his feet are horrible. And yet people still pay his 22k stud fee (used to be 65k)
